David Zwirner presents new works and cross-generational pairings at Frieze Seoul

festival-fair · 2026-08-30

David Zwirner's exhibition at Frieze Seoul showcases an eclectic array of artworks from both emerging talents and renowned figures. The display highlights the works of artists including Francis Alÿs, Suzan Frecon, and Dana Schutz, fostering a dialogue among diverse styles and generations. Also featured are renowned names like Yayoi Kusama, Gerhard Richter, and Wolfgang Tillmans. Katherine Bernhardt, who is currently the subject of a traveling retrospective at the Cube Art Museum in Seongnam Arts Center until September 6, adds to the attraction. The exhibition emphasizes Zwirner's dedication to presenting a broad spectrum of artistic voices at this prestigious event.

Key facts

  • David Zwirner is exhibiting at Frieze Seoul.
  • The booth includes new works by Francis Alÿs, Suzan Frecon, Walter Price, Dana Schutz, Rirkrit Tiravanija, Rose Wylie, and Katherine Bernhardt.
  • Works by Mamma Andersson, Michaël Borremans, Scott Kahn, Yayoi Kusama, Gerhard Richter, Steven Shearer, Wolfgang Tillmans, and Luc Tuymans are also featured.
  • Katherine Bernhardt has a traveling retrospective at the Cube Art Museum at Seongnam Arts Center through September 6.
  • The presentation includes two new paintings by Brazilian artist Lucas Arruda.
  • The gallery is creating smaller conversations between artists, generations, and approaches to painting.
  • The fair is Frieze Seoul, an international art fair.
  • The booth combines newly made works with paintings and photographs.
